Tesla Launches Model Y “Juniper” In China

Tesla has unveiled a redesigned Model Y specifically for the Chinese and other Asian-Pacific markets, marking the first significant update to the SUV since its 2020 launch.

The new Model Y, the world’s most popular electric vehicle, is slated to start deliveries as early as March in China and some surrounding countries.

The new Model has price range between 263,500 – 303,500 yuan (35,950 – 41,400 USD), the U.S. automaker said on Friday.

The refreshed Model Y, codenamed “Juniper,” boasts a striking new look with a prominent Cybertruck-inspired LED lightbar. The headlights have been repositioned to the front bumper, and the vehicle features redesigned 19-inch and 20-inch wheels, flush door handles, and a fresh coat of blue paint.

Dimensions have slightly increased, with the Juniper now measuring 4797mm long, 1920mm wide, and 1624mm tall, with a 2890mm wheelbase. These subtle changes contribute to a more aerodynamic profile, resulting in an improved drag coefficient of 0.22 Cd compared to the previous model’s 0.23 Cd.

The new Model Y interior mirrors the new Model 3 with an ambient light bar encircling most of the cabin, customizable in various colors. Enhanced features include powered rear seats, a dedicated touchscreen for rear passengers, and improved suspension and noise reduction.

Maintaining Tesla’s minimalist aesthetic, the 15-inch center touchscreen, powered by AMD Ryzen, replaces a traditional instrument cluster. This display integrates vital vehicle information like speed, gear, and ADAS status. The center console eschews buttons for a wireless charging pad and concealed storage compartments.

The Tesla Model Y Juniper is available in China with both Rear-Wheel Drive (RWD) and All-Wheel Drive (AWD) configurations. Both models utilize a 400V architecture.

RWD Model Y Juniper:

– Powered by a single rear-mounted e-motor producing 220 kW (295 hp).
– Equipped with a 62.5 kWh LFP battery pack from CATL.
– Acc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 5.9 seconds.
– Offers a CLTC range of 593 km, an increase of 39 km due to improved energy consumption of 11.9 kWh/100 km.

AWD Model Y Juniper:

– Features dual motors: 194 kW (260 hp) in the rear and 137 kW (184 hp) in the front, delivering a combined output of 331 kW (444 hp).
– Powered by a 78.4 kWh NMC battery pack from LG.
– Acc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 4.3 seconds.
– Offers a CLTC range of 719 km, an increase of 31 km due to improved energy consumption of 13.4 kWh/100 km.

The redesigned Model Y comes as Tesla finished 2024 having delivered fewer vehicles than it did in 2023. It was the first year-over-year drop since the company started selling mass market cars in 2012.
